【如何实现多个服务器文件的同步? 怎么让多个服务器文件同步】在企业中 , 经常会有多个服务器用于存储不同的数据 , 但是这些数据需要实时同步,以保证数据的准确性和一致性 。本文将介绍如何使得多个服务器文件同步,并提供一些有效的工具和技巧 。
1. 使用 rsync 工具进行同步
Rsync 是一个常用的文件同步工具 , 它能够快速、安全地同步文件和目录,具有强大的功能和灵活的配置选项 。相较于其它同步工具,rsync 的同步效率更高,耗费的带宽更少 。
2. 使用分布式文件系统进行同步
分布式文件系统可以让不同服务器之间共享文件系统 , 从而实现数据同步 。例如,GlusterFS 就是一个开源的分布式文件系统,支持多种操作系统平台,可以扩展到无限数量的节点 。该系统可以自动复制文件到其他存储磁盘,从而实现同步 。
3. 使用云存储服务进行同步
云存储服务可以将数据存储在云端 , 通过 API 接口进行访问和同步 。最常见的云存储服务包括 Amazon S3、Google Cloud Storage 和 Microsoft Azure 等 。
4. 使用同步工具进行监控和同步
除了 rsync 外,还有一些同步工具可以用于监控文件和目录的变化,并在发生变化时进行自动同步 。例如,FileSync 可以定期检测文件变更并自动同步,而 Unison 则可以在不同平台之间同步文件 。
为了实现多个服务器文件的同步,可以采用 rsync 工具、分布式文件系统、云存储服务和同步工具等多种方法 。选择适合自己企业的同步方案,可以大大提高数据的准确性和一致性 。
推荐阅读
- 如何使用常见的服务器框架? 一般服务器框架怎么用
- 如果邮件服务器关机了该如何找回邮件? 邮件服务器关机了怎么找回
- 如何描述一台普通服务器的内存? 一般服务器的内存怎么表示
- 如何让夸克浏览器连接代理服务器? 怎么让夸克支持代理服务器
- 当邮件服务器关机时应该怎么处理? 邮件服务器关机怎么办
- 如何正确放置一般服务器中的图片? 一般服务器的图片怎么放置